Your Itinerary

St Giles' Cathedral

Stop nearby St Giles to see this magnificent building and find out about the famous peoples from it's past.

Admission Not Included

Advocate's Close

We stop so you can get this Iconic view down to the New Town.

Royal Mile

We drove down the Royal Mile stopping to get some amazing views and explore a bit more.

White Horse Close

See this stunning little close tucked away off the Royal Mile.

Edinburgh Castle

We stop to give you some great views of the castle from different locations on this tour. If you want to visit inside the castle we can drop you off nearby and pick you up when you finish.

Admission Not Included

Palace of Holyroodhouse

We can stop to see Holyrood Palace, but if you want to visit inside we can drop you off and wait for you.

Admission Not Included

Royal Yacht Britannia

If you want to visit the Royal Yacht Britannia, we can take you there and wait as you explore on the self guided tour there.

Admission Not Included

Rosslyn Chapel

For any Da Vinci code or Knights Templar fans, we can take you to Rosslyn Chapel outside of Edinburgh. If you want to visit this will be your first stop of the day other than on Sundays when it would have to e after service.

Admission Not Included

Greyfriars Kirk

Stop to wander this amazing old graveyard and find out about it's rather fascinating past.

Leith

Stop for lunch where the locals eat in Leith, with eateries for every taste and some great local pubs there is something for everyone.

Admission Not Included

Stockbridge

Drive along stunning Circus Lane and explore this lovely local part of Edinburgh.

Dean Village

Step back in time to the 1600's with this amazingly well preserved part of Edinburgh. You won't believe you are in the Capital City of Scotland.

Cramond Village

Explore this lovely little village down by the coast if we have time.
